Abrasive waterjet cutting machines are essential tools in manufacturing and industrial operations where precision cutting of metals, composites, stone, and other materials is required. Unlike conventional cutting methods, abrasive waterjets use high-pressure water mixed with abrasive particles to cut materials without generating heat, thereby preserving the structural integrity of the material. This technology is widely used across aerospace, automotive, construction, and fabrication industries.

Technological Advancements

Recent advancements in waterjet technology include higher-pressure systems, CNC integration, and improved abrasive delivery mechanisms. CNC-controlled waterjets offer automated and precise cutting, allowing complex shapes and intricate designs. Hybrid systems combining waterjet with other cutting technologies are being developed for enhanced efficiency. Additionally, software advancements allow real-time monitoring, predictive maintenance, and optimization of cutting paths, reducing operational costs and increasing throughput.

Market Challenges

High initial investment and operating costs are key challenges. Abrasive waterjets require continuous supply of abrasive material and high-pressure pumps, which can be expensive to maintain. Skilled operators are needed to manage complex machinery and ensure optimal performance. Additionally, energy consumption and disposal of used abrasive materials pose environmental considerations that manufacturers need to address.

FAQs

Q1: What materials can abrasive waterjet machines cut?
A1: They can cut metals, ceramics, glass, composites, stone, and heat-sensitive materials with high precision.

Q2: How does waterjet cutting differ from laser cutting?
A2: Waterjet cutting uses high-pressure water with abrasive particles and does not generate heat, preserving material integrity, while lasers can cause heat-affected zones.

Q3: Which industries commonly use abrasive waterjet machines?
A3: Aerospace, automotive, construction, fabrication, and defense industries extensively use abrasive waterjet technology for precision cutting.
